Transaction f74e58536277982ae9620f104a36051699cbf27c76cf24ffe2167b6866f138f8

1 Input
2 Outputs
  • f74e58536277982ae9620f104a36051699cbf27c76cf24ffe2167b6866f138f8:0
  • value  644527
    address  39JYLjN6rHbhnk7kAnZxFq7eBzY1EyTQ97
  • f74e58536277982ae9620f104a36051699cbf27c76cf24ffe2167b6866f138f8:1
  • value  3409231
    address  3FkEH816u5r9wvNfWTYdxRJm68BGxxurd5